WebSep 11, 2024 · Alkaline phosphatase (ALP) levels that are considered normal differ by age and status of pregnancy. In adults, an ALP range of … WebFeb 27, 2024 · Dr. Mark Kuhnke answered. No: An isolated lab abnormality, low or high, is probably not of concern. The bell curve of standard deviations tells us that 2% of the population will have lab values higher the "normal, "and 2% will have lower. If you alk phos is an isolated finding i would not be concerned.

WebLevels of alkaline phosphatase ranged from 1,014 to 3,360 U/l. Ten patients had sepsis as the cause of the elevated alkaline phosphatase. These included gram-negative … WebThe normal range for aminotransferase levels in most clinical laboratories is much lower than that for the alkaline phosphatase level. Accordingly, when considering levels of elevations, it is necessary to consider them relative to the respective upper limit of normal for each test compared. Consider a patient with an AST level of 120 IU/mL ...

An ALP test measures how much ALP is circulating in the blood stream. … iphone stand diy credit cardWebAlkaline phosphatase (ALP) is a protein found in all body tissues. Tissues with higher amounts of ALP include the liver, bile ducts, and bone. A blood test can be done to measure the level of ALP. A related test is the ALP isoenzyme test.
